摘要
从黄观音、茗科1号、福鼎大毫茶、福鼎大白茶、福安大白茶5个供试品种中分离到茶树内生细菌共79株,并利用平板对峙法筛选出对茶炭疽病菌具有较强拮抗作用的茶树内生细菌5株,测定结果表明其对茶炭疽病平均抑制率达到60.09%.利用普通光学显微镜和扫描电镜观察,发现目标菌株均可有效抑制茶炭疽病菌菌丝的生长.
Seventy-nine strains of endophytic bacteria were isolated and purified from the 5 cultivars(Camellia sinensis cv Huangguanyin,C.sinensis cv Mingke 1,C.sinensis cv Fuding-dahaocha,C.sinensis cv Fuding-dabaicha,C.sinensis cv Fuan-dabaicha).By flat-stand method 5 target strains of endophytic bacteria which had strong inhibitory effect on Gloeosporium theae sinensis Miyake were screened,the average inhibition rate was 60.09%.Observation result showed the target strains could inhibit the mycelial growth of G.theae sinensis.
